|  | int sdl_zoom_blit(SDL_Surface *src_sfc, SDL_Surface *dst_sfc, int smooth, | 
|  | SDL_Rect *in_rect) | 
|  | { | 
|  | SDL_Rect zoom, src_rect; | 
|  | int extra;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* Grow the size of the modified rectangle to avoid edge artefacts */ | 
|  | src_rect.x = (in_rect->x > 0) ? (in_rect->x - 1) : 0; | 
|  | src_rect.y = (in_rect->y > 0) ? (in_rect->y - 1) : 0; | 
|  |  | 
|  | src_rect.w = in_rect->w + 1; | 
|  | if (src_rect.x + src_rect.w > src_sfc->w) | 
|  | src_rect.w = src_sfc->w - src_rect.x; | 
|  |  | 
|  | src_rect.h = in_rect->h + 1; | 
|  | if (src_rect.y + src_rect.h > src_sfc->h) | 
|  | src_rect.h = src_sfc->h - src_rect.y;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* (x,y) : round down */ | 
|  | zoom.x = (int)(((float)(src_rect.x * dst_sfc->w)) / (float)(src_sfc->w)); | 
|  | zoom.y = (int)(((float)(src_rect.y * dst_sfc->h)) / (float)(src_sfc->h)); |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* (w,h) : round up */ | 
|  | zoom.w = (int)( ((double)((src_rect.w * dst_sfc->w) + (src_sfc->w - 1))) / | 
|  | (double)(src_sfc->w)); | 
|  |  | 
|  | zoom.h = (int)( ((double)((src_rect.h * dst_sfc->h) + (src_sfc->h - 1))) / | 
|  | (double)(src_sfc->h)); |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* Account for any (x,y) rounding by adding one-source-pixel's worth | 
|  | * of destination pixels and then edge checking. | 
|  | */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| extra = ((dst_sfc->w-1) / src_sfc->w) + 1; | 
|  |  | 
|  | if ((zoom.x + zoom.w) < (dst_sfc->w - extra)) | 
|  | zoom.w += extra; | 
|  | else | 
|  | zoom.w = dst_sfc->w - zoom.x; | 
|  |  | 
|  | extra = ((dst_sfc->h-1) / src_sfc->h) + 1; | 
|  |  | 
|  | if ((zoom.y + zoom.h) < (dst_sfc->h - extra)) | 
|  | zoom.h += extra; | 
|  | else | 
|  | zoom.h = dst_sfc->h - zoom.y;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* The rectangle (zoom.x, zoom.y, zoom.w, zoom.h) is the area on the | 
|  | * destination surface that needs to be updated.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| if (src_sfc->format->BitsPerPixel == 32) | 
|  | sdl_zoom_rgb32(src_sfc, dst_sfc, smooth, &zoom); | 
|  | else if (src_sfc->format->BitsPerPixel == 16) | 
|  | sdl_zoom_rgb16(src_sfc, dst_sfc, smooth, &zoom); | 
|  | else { | 
|  | fprintf(stderr, "pixel format not supported\n"); | 
|  | return -1;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* Return the rectangle of the update to the caller */ | 
|  | *in_rect = zoom; |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} |
